- ©«¤l
- 2839
- ¥DÃD
- 10
- ºëµØ
- 0
- ¿n¤À
- 2895
- ÂI¦W
- 0
- §@·~¨t²Î
- ¡e²¤¡f
- ³nÅ骩¥»
- ¡e²¤¡f
- ¾\ŪÅv
- 100
- ©Ê§O
- ¨k
- ¨Ó¦Û
- ¡e²¤¡f
- µù¥U®É¶¡
- 2013-5-13
- ³Ì«áµn¿ý
- 2024-12-20
|
¦^´_ 22# PJChen
Sub ¼t¯Ê¶×Á`_¶×¤J()
Dim Arr, R&, ¼t¯Ê¼Æ&, ¤J¼Æ&, N&
Call ¼t¯Ê¶×Á`_²M°£
Arr = Range([¸¤ñ!A1], [¸¤ñ!BI65536].End(xlUp))
For R = 4 To UBound(Arr)
¼t¯Ê¼Æ = Val(Arr(R, UBound(Arr, 2)))
¤J¼Æ = Val(Arr(R, 7))
If ¼t¯Ê¼Æ * ¤J¼Æ = 0 Then GoTo 101
N = N + 1
Arr(N, 1) = Arr(R, 6)
Arr(N, 2) = Arr(R, 5)
Arr(N, 3) = Arr(R, 8)
Arr(N, 4) = ¤J¼Æ
Arr(N, 5) = ¼t¯Ê¼Æ Mod ¤J¼Æ
Arr(N, 6) = Int(¼t¯Ê¼Æ / ¤J¼Æ)
101: Next R
If N = 0 Then Exit Sub
With [¼t¯Ê¶×Á`!A3:F3].Resize(N)
.Rows(1).Copy .Cells
.Value = Arr
End With
End Sub
Sub ¼t¯Ê¶×Á`_²M°£()
With Sheets("¼t¯Ê¶×Á`")
.UsedRange.Offset(3, 0).EntireRow.Delete
.[A3:F3].ClearContents
End With
End Sub
============================ |
|